I want to add a very simple bit of code to a jsfiddle, but when ever I do it breaks everything else. This is the code I’d like to add:

$("#launcher").click(function(){
  $("#profile_850_HEADER").animate({
    margin-top: "10px"
}, 1500 );
});

and this is the jsfiddle http://jsfiddle.net/loriensleafs/F3wjg/3/ , I’m sure this is beyond simple but I can’t figure it out, any help would be greatly appreciated.

    margin-top: "10px" should be:

     marginTop: "10px"
    

    Or

     'margin-top': "10px"
    

    Or simply (my preferred):

     marginTop: 10
    

    The unquoted - (minus/hyphen sign) is not allowed in property names and results in a syntax error.
